Transition from Flash to HTML5
The transition from Adobe Flash to HTML5 marked a major turning point for online casinos, enhancing the user experience considerably. Flash had been the cornerstone of online gaming for many years, allowing developers to create visually appealing games with engaging animations and sound effects. However, Adobe Flash came with drawbacks, such as issues with compatibility with mobile devices and a reliance on plugins for browsers that often created security risks. As technology progressed and the demand for mobile-friendly gaming grew, the industry recognized the need for a more flexible solution.
HTML5 emerged as the superior option, offering seamless integration across multiple platforms without the need for extra plugins. This change enabled online casinos to create games that could run smoothly on desktops, tablets, and smartphones. The shift to HTML 5 made it simpler for developers to create responsive designs that adjusted to different screen sizes and resolutions, ensuring that players could enjoy their favorite games anytime and anywhere. This convenience played a vital role in attracting a larger audience to the world of online gaming.
Furthermore, HTML 5 provided improved graphics and audio capabilities, allowing for a more immersive gaming experience. With this technology, online casinos could upgrade their offerings with vibrant visual effects, sophisticated gameplay mechanics, and dynamic features that kept players involved. As the casino industry embraced HTML 5, it not only transformed game development but also set the stage for future innovations, such as live dealer games, solidifying the online casino industry’s position in the ever-evolving digital landscape.
